会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 9. 发明专利
    • DE60121066T2
    • 2006-10-19
    • DE60121066
    • 2001-12-19
    • HITACHI LTD
    • KAMINAGA MASAHIROENDO TAKASHIWATANABE TAKASHI
    • G06F12/14H04L9/30G06F7/72G06F21/06G06F21/24G06K19/07G09C1/00H04L9/10
    • The present invention makes it difficult for unauthorized parties to estimate processing and a secret key based upon the waveforms of power consumption of an IC card chip (102) by changing a processing order in the IC card chip (102) so that it is not estimated by the attackers. In an information processing apparatus comprising storing means (204) having a program storing part (205) for storing programs and a data storing part (206) for storing data, an operation processing unit (201), means (207) for inputting data to be operated on in the operation processing unit (201), and means (207) for outputting operation processing results on the data by the operation processing unit (201), an arithmetic operation method is provided which comprises the steps of: for two integers K1 and K2, when finding a value F(K, A) of a function F satisfying F(K1 + K2; A)=F(K1, A)OF(K2,A) (O denotes an arithmetic operation in a commutative semigroup S. K designates an integer and A designates an element of S), decomposing the K to the sum of m integers KÄ0Ü + KÄ1Ü + ...KÄm-1Ü; using T(0), T(1), ... T(m-1) resulting from rearranging a string of the m integers 0, 1, ... m-1 by permutation T (the result corresponds one for one to the integer string 0, 1, ... m-1); and operating on terms F(KÄT(0)Ü, A) to F(KÄT(m-1)Ü, A) on the right side of F(K, A) = F(KÄT(0)Ü, A)OF(KÄT(1)Ü, A)O ...F(KÄT(m-1)Ü, A) in the order of F(KÄT(0)Ü, A), F(KÄT(1)Ü, A) ... F(KÄT(m-1)Ü, A) to find F(K, A).